C Programming Language & Communication by Tanya Batwani

DurationDuration:2 hours

Batch TypeBatch Type:Weekend and Weekdays

LanguagesLanguages:English, Hindi

Class TypeClass Type:Online and Offline

Class TypeAddress:Kamla Nagar, Agra

Class Type Course Fee:Call for fee

Course Content

This Online C Programming and Communication Skills Course is designed to help learners build a strong foundation in both technical coding abilities and essential language communication skills. The course combines practical programming training in the C language with guidance to improve clarity in technical communication, making it ideal for students who want to strengthen their academic performance and technical confidence.

The program is suitable for school students, beginners in programming, diploma and engineering aspirants, and anyone starting their journey in computer science. It focuses on teaching core C programming concepts step-by-step while also helping students develop the ability to understand, explain, and communicate technical ideas effectively.

By integrating programming logic with communication skills, this course ensures students gain both technical competence and confidence in expressing their knowledge.

What Students Will Learn

Students will develop both coding and communication capabilities:

C Programming Fundamentals

  • Introduction to programming concepts and C language basics

  • Understanding syntax and structure of C programs

  • Variables, data types, and operators

  • Input and output statements

  • Conditional statements and control structures

  • Loops and iteration techniques

  • Functions and modular programming basics

  • Writing and debugging simple C programs

Programming Logic Development

  • Problem-solving approaches

  • Algorithm thinking fundamentals

  • Understanding program flow and logic building

Language & Communication Skills

  • Understanding technical instructions clearly

  • Explaining programming concepts effectively

  • Improving clarity in spoken and written communication

  • Building confidence in technical discussions

Teaching Method

The course is delivered through live online interactive sessions that provide a supportive learning environment. The teaching approach includes:

  • Step-by-step explanations of concepts

  • Live coding demonstrations

  • Practical exercises and assignments

  • Real-time doubt clearing

  • Simple explanations for beginners

  • Interactive learning activities

This ensures that students learn at a comfortable pace while gaining strong conceptual clarity.

Why This Tutor

The course is guided by a dedicated instructor who focuses on simplifying programming concepts and helping learners build confidence in both coding and communication. The teaching style emphasizes clarity, patience, and hands-on practice, making it suitable even for complete beginners.

Students are encouraged to actively participate, ask questions, and practice regularly.

Benefits & Outcomes

After completing this course, students will:

  • Develop a strong foundation in C programming

  • Improve logical thinking and problem-solving skills

  • Gain confidence in understanding technical subjects

  • Enhance communication skills for academic success

  • Prepare for advanced programming learning

  • Build a solid base for computer science studies

This course provides a balanced combination of technical training and communication skill development, essential for future academic and professional growth.

Skills

C Basics, C Language, C Programming

Tutor

0.0 Average Ratings

0 Reviews

7 Years Experience

K-28 karamyogi

Students Rating

0.0

Course Rating

Blogs

Explore All
arrow
arrow